Transaction 626c63ee3276c8c3ded162624952ae9c4fd78d39a2a2ae6b287cf4abae8073eb
1 Input
1 Output
-
626c63ee3276c8c3ded162624952ae9c4fd78d39a2a2ae6b287cf4abae8073eb:0
- value
- 964213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98f83703fa656a0596c6a4e53179f4f1d18a23ec OP_EQUAL
- address
- 3FdqyyZ8o5WHGnerRpppQaciEBoANufKAF